FA890323F0127 — REPAIR/RENOVATE STUDENT DORM BUILDING 10656 AT JBSA LACKLAND, TX PROJECT NO: MPLS100004

REPAIR/RENOVATE STUDENT DORM BUILDING 10656 AT JBSA LACKLAND, TX PROJECT NO: MPLS100004 is a federal award for Department of Defense (DOD) held by CUSTOM MECHANICAL SYSTEMS, CORP.. Estimated value $17.5M ($15.2M obligated). Current period of performance ends Oct 25, 2026. Last award drew 4 bidders. Place of performance: SAN ANTONIO TX.
